网站有数据库功能吗为什么
-
是的,很多网站都具有数据库功能。数据库是用于存储和管理大量数据的工具,它可以提供高效的数据访问和处理能力。以下是网站使用数据库功能的原因:
-
数据存储和管理:网站通常需要存储大量的数据,如用户信息、文章内容、商品信息等。数据库可以提供结构化的数据存储和管理,方便网站对数据进行增删改查操作。
-
数据安全性:数据库可以提供数据的安全性保障。通过数据库的权限控制机制,网站可以限制用户对数据的访问权限,保护敏感数据的安全。
-
数据一致性和完整性:数据库可以确保数据的一致性和完整性。通过数据库的事务管理机制,网站可以确保数据的操作是原子性、一致性、隔离性和持久性的,避免数据出现错误或丢失。
-
数据查询和分析:数据库提供了强大的查询和分析功能,可以帮助网站对数据进行高效的检索和统计分析。网站可以利用数据库的查询语言和索引机制,快速地获取所需的数据。
-
数据的持久性和可扩展性:数据库可以将数据持久化存储在硬盘上,即使网站服务器出现故障或重启,数据也不会丢失。此外,数据库还支持数据的备份和恢复,提供了可扩展性,可以根据网站的需求进行水平或垂直扩展。
总之,数据库功能对于网站来说非常重要,它可以提供数据的安全性、一致性、完整性和高效性,帮助网站实现数据的存储、管理、查询和分析。
1年前 -
-
是的,网站可以具备数据库功能。数据库是用于存储和管理数据的一种软件系统。它可以帮助网站收集、存储和处理大量的数据,以便进行各种操作和分析。
首先,数据库可以提供数据的持久化存储。网站上的数据通常需要长期保存,以便在需要的时候可以进行查询和使用。使用数据库可以将数据存储在硬盘上,即使服务器关闭或重新启动,数据也不会丢失。
其次,数据库可以实现数据的高效管理和查询。当网站上的数据量较大时,使用数据库可以提高数据的访问速度和查询效率。数据库系统通常采用索引和优化算法来加快数据的检索和处理,从而提高网站的性能和响应速度。
此外,数据库还可以实现数据的安全性和一致性。通过数据库的权限管理和事务处理功能,可以确保只有授权的用户才能访问和修改数据,从而保护数据的安全性。同时,数据库还可以通过事务处理来保证数据的一致性,即保证数据的更新操作是原子性的,要么全部执行成功,要么全部回滚,避免了数据的不一致性问题。
最后,数据库还可以实现数据的备份和恢复。网站上的数据可能会遭受各种意外情况的影响,如硬件故障、网络故障等。使用数据库可以定期进行数据备份,以便在需要时可以快速恢复数据,减少数据丢失的风险。
综上所述,网站使用数据库功能可以提供数据的持久化存储、高效管理和查询、数据安全性和一致性、以及数据的备份和恢复等功能,从而提高网站的功能和性能。
1年前 -
是的,大多数网站都具有数据库功能。数据库是用来存储、管理和检索数据的软件系统。在网站中,数据库的功能非常重要,它可以用来存储用户信息、商品信息、文章内容等各种数据。有以下几个原因说明为什么网站需要数据库功能:
-
数据存储和管理:网站需要存储大量的数据,包括用户信息、文章内容、商品信息等等。数据库可以提供一个结构化的方式来存储和管理这些数据,使得数据的读写更加高效和方便。
-
数据的检索和查询:网站需要根据用户的需求来检索和查询数据。数据库提供了强大的查询语言和索引机制,可以快速地找到所需的数据。用户可以通过网站的搜索功能或者筛选条件来查询符合自己需求的数据。
-
数据的更新和修改:网站的数据是经常会发生变化的,比如用户的个人信息可能会被修改,商品的库存可能会变动等等。数据库可以提供更新和修改数据的功能,使得网站能够及时地反映数据的变化。
-
数据的安全性和保护:网站上的数据往往是敏感的,比如用户的个人信息、订单信息等。数据库可以提供安全的机制来保护数据的安全性,比如用户认证和权限管理等。同时,数据库还可以提供数据备份和恢复的功能,以防止数据的丢失。
-
数据的共享和复用:数据库可以为不同的应用程序提供数据共享的功能。多个应用程序可以通过访问同一个数据库来获取和修改数据,避免了数据的冗余和不一致性。
综上所述,数据库功能在网站中是非常重要的。它可以有效地管理和存储数据,提供数据的查询和修改功能,保护数据的安全性,同时还可以实现数据的共享和复用。
1年前 -